Need help
If you or someone you know has experienced sexual assault, please remember you have options. The National Sexual Assault Hotline is here for you at any time, offering a safe space to talk. Call 1-800-656-4673 to connect with a trained advocate who can listen without judgment about your next steps. You are worthy of help.
